Why do I keep throwing up after I eat not pregnant?

The timing of the nausea or vomiting can indicate the cause. When appearing shortly after a meal, nausea or vomiting may be caused by food poisoning, gastritis (inflammation of the stomach lining), an ulcer, or bulimia. Nausea or vomiting one to eight hours after a meal may also indicate food poisoning.

Can vomiting be caused by not eating?

Why not eating may cause nausea To help break down food, your stomach produces hydrochloric acid. If you don’t eat for a long period of time, that acid can build up in your stomach and potentially lead to acid reflux and nausea.

Why do I feel sick everyday not pregnant?

Everyone feels sick sometimes, but in some circumstances, a person can feel sick all or most of the time. This feeling can refer to nausea, catching colds often, or being run-down. A person might feel sick continuously for a few days, weeks, or months due to a lack of sleep, stress, anxiety, or a poor diet.

What does it mean when you can’t keep food down during pregnancy?

You may have hyperemesis gravidarum (HG), which means excessive vomiting in pregnancy. HG is diagnosed when you become so sick that you lose some of your pregnancy weight. You’ll become dehydrated because you can’t keep drinks down, so your wee may look dark yellow. or even brown.

What foods can you eat if you are nauseated during pregnancy?

You may more easily tolerate dry, salty snacks like pretzels and crackers, as well as bland foods like baked chicken breast. However, you may need to see a health professional if you experience more serious cases of nausea and vomiting during pregnancy.
